    TV.com says:

    12.01 ''73 Seconds''
    A crazy, chaotic shoot-out on a hotel tram leaves two dead, almost no witnesses, and a lot of contradictory evidence; another dead man in Panaca County has a young man's face and an old man's body...

    12.02 "The Pageant"
    The CSIs investigate the murder of a 12 year old beauty queen. Meanwhile, an agent from Internal Affairs questions the rest of the team about Nate Haskell's murder.
